On the season finale of Changing Lives through Education Abroad, host Zac Macinnes is joined by Kate Hellman and Sebastian Fernandes, two leaders from the Climate Action Network for International Educators (CANIE). Together, they explore CANIE’s grassroots origins, the global momentum behind the CANIE Accords, and how the international education sector can take bold, practical steps toward climate justice. From institutional transformation to individual advocacy, this conversation offers inspiration, strategy, and a clear call to action for educators ready to lead the charge. Whether you’re just starting your sustainability journey or looking to deepen your impact, this episode is your guide to meaningful engagement with climate action in our field.
